Manila Water speeds up project for cleaner waterways in QC, Marikina

Manila Water is fast-tracking the Batasan–Balara Flow Diversion Project to boost water quality, community cleanliness, and public health in Quezon City and Marikina. The initiative redirects wastewater from the area to the Marikina North Sewage Treatment Plant, keeping untreated waste out of local creeks and rivers and cutting down water pollution.
